I'm taking a pretty big step away from the buses I'm familiar with but here goes: I believe that the right hand heat exchanger is the same on both the 49 state and California air cooled Vanagons. This heat exchanger, the muffler and tail pipe are the only exhaust system parts that the two versions have in common, I think. Perhaps you could use the right hand exchanger that was sent to you from AVP with a left side exchanger obtained from a 49 state Vanagon. What kind of shape is your collector and "U" pipe in? Some of the exhaust system parts may be shared with the '79 bus <that year only> but not the heat exchangers <buses got some of the heater air from the fan housing, Vanagons get it from that plastic fan on the alternator.>
